Compare all specifications:
1964 Honda S600 | 1977 Renault 15 | |
Make | Honda | Renault |
Model | S600 | 15 |
Year Released | 1964 | 1977 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 606 cc | 1289 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 54 HP | 59 HP |
Engine RPM | 8500 RPM | 5500 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 54.5 mm | 75 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 65 mm | 69 mm |
Number of Seats | 2 seats | 4 seats |
Number of Doors | 2 doors | 3 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 730 kg | 965 kg |
Vehicle Length | 3340 mm | 4270 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1410 mm | 1640 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1230 mm | 1320 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2010 mm | 2440 mm |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 25 L | 55 L |
